Kate Winslet Calls Husband Edward Abel Smith A 'Superhot, Superhuman, Stay-At-Home Dad'
Titanic star Kate Winslet tied the knot with Edward Abel Smith in 2012 and the two even share a seven-year-old son, Bear Blaze. However, recently, she was swooning over her husband Edward Abel Smith during an interview where she also called him a ‘superhot, superhuman, stay-at-home dad’. In an interview with New York Times, she candidly spoke about her husband and how he looks after her. She even called him ‘an absolutely extraordinary life partner’.

“He looks after us, especially me. I said to him earlier, like, ‘Neddy, could you do something for me?’ He just went, ‘Anything,’” she told the NYT, adding “He is an absolutely extraordinary life partner.” She continued, “I’m so, so, so lucky. For a man who is severely dyslexic, as he is, he's great at testing me on lines. It's so hard for him to read out loud, but he still does it.” The Oscar winner further admitted that Abel Smith “didn't particularly plan on meeting and marrying a woman who is in the public eye and therefore having been so judged” but he handles it well. 

“He’s vegan, does yoga, breath work and cold water swims,” she told the New York Times. Apart from Bear Blaze, Winslet is also mom to daughter Mia, 20, and son Joe, 17, from her previous marriages.


On the professional front, Kate Winslet was last seen in Ammonite and Black Beauty which was released in 2020. The actor is now gearing up for Avatar 2.
